Kath and Kim is classified as a situational comedy. Meaning the situations can be constantly changed and molded to the show creators liking. This allows for total freedom in portraying any number of comedy inclusions, guests, and story lines. NBC has announced that they will not keep Kath and Kim on the roster after 2009. The reviews were absolutely terrible, but the ratings were strong. Critics complained the show was the worst remake of the original Australian version they have ever seen. Others see the show in a more positive light but they will definitely not be back on NBC for a second season.
